How much do entry level management j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 20, 2026, the average yearly pay for entry level management in Elgin, IL is $47,281.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$40,000.00 and $51,400.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

How to get an entry level management job?

Whether you’re just starting your career or you want a promotion to an Entry-Level Management role, you need specific qualifications. Many employers require you to have a bachelor’s degree to qualify for a management job. Your degree field can be business or a subject relevant to your work. You must demonstrate your ability to handle management-level responsibilities, including motivating and supervising a diverse team of people, handling administrative tasks and paperwork, and developing and implementing strategic plans for the company. Your duties require you to manage staff and tap into your leadership skills.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an entry level manager?

To thrive as an Entry Level Manager, you need a foundation in business administration, organizational skills, and basic leadership principles, often supported by a relevant degree or equivalent experience. Familiarity with project management software, productivity tools like Microsoft Office, and sometimes introductory management certifications is beneficial. Strong interpersonal communication, problem-solving abilities, and adaptability help you lead teams and resolve everyday challenges. These skills are crucial for effectively supervising staff, ensuring smooth operations, and building a successful management career.

What are the most common challenges faced by professionals in entry level management positions?

Entry level management professionals often encounter challenges such as balancing team leadership with learning new operational processes, adapting to a supervisory role, and managing time effectively between administrative tasks and team support. Navigating relationships with both upper management and team members can also be demanding, as new managers must earn trust while ensuring company goals are met. Continuous feedback, mentorship, and training are important resources to help overcome these initial hurdles and build confidence in the role.
